Former federal minister Fawad Chaudhry claimed that leaders of the ruling Pakistan Muslim League-Nawaz (PML-N) were taken by surprise by the government's announcement to ban the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I). Speaking during an interview on a local news channel on Wednesday, he emphasised that the government must justify its decision to ban PTI. “Even PML-N leaders were surprised by the announcement of banning PTI,” Chaudhry said, highlighting that the country’s politics cannot move forward without the party's founder. He added that many Pakistanis continue to support Imran Khan despite his imprisonment. Chaudhry criticised PTI’s current strategy, stating it has failed to secure Khan's release from jail. “My criticism is not on PTI leadership, but on strategy. PTI is a big party, but the strategy adopted is not right,” he added. He suggested that PTI should form alliances with parties like JUI-F, JI, and GDA to strengthen its position. He reiterated the need for PTI to adopt a better political strategy and collaborate with other parties to exert pressure for Khan’s release.
